Summary
A vulnerability was found in zauberzeug nicegui up to 3.3.x. It has been rated as problematic. Affected by this issue is some unknown functionality of the component interactive_image. This manipulation causes cross site scripting. This vulnerability appears as CVE-2025-66470. The attack may be initiated remotely. There is no available exploit. Upgrading the affected component is advised.
Details
A vulnerability has been found in zauberzeug nicegui up to 3.3.x and classified as problematic. Affected by this vulnerability is an unknown function of the component interactive_image.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a cross site scripting vulnerability. The CWE definition for the vulnerability is CWE-79. The product does not neutralize or incorrectly neutralizes user-controllable input before it is placed in output that is used as a web page that is served to other users. As an impact it is known to affect integrity. The summary by CVE is:
NiceGUI is a Python-based UI framework. Versions 3.3.1 and below are subject to a XSS vulnerability through the ui.interactive_image component of NiceGUI. The component renders SVG content using Vue's v-html directive without any sanitization. This allows attackers to inject malicious HTML or JavaScript via the SVG <foreignObject> tag whenever the image component is rendered or updated. This is particularly dangerous for dashboards or multi-user applications displaying user-generated content or annotations. This issue is fixed in version 3.4.0.
It is possible to read the advisory at github.com. This vulnerability is known as CVE-2025-66470 since 12/02/2025. The exploitation appears to be easy. The attack can be launched remotely. The exploitation doesn't need any form of authentication. It demands that the victim is doing some kind of user interaction. The technical details are unknown and an exploit is not publicly available. The attack technique deployed by this issue is T1059.007 according to MITRE ATT&CK.
Upgrading to version 3.4.0 eliminates this vulnerability. Applying the patch 58ad0b36e19922de16bbc79ea3ddd29851b1a3e3 is able to eliminate this problem. The bugfix is ready for download at github.com. The best possible mitigation is suggested to be upgrading to the latest version.
